VB6 developers often wrote Form_Resize code to manually reposition controls. .NET’s Resize event fires more frequently (during dragging). Instead:
The "rewrite vs. migrate" debate often ends with companies realizing a rewrite is too risky and expensive. offers the middle path: the speed of automated conversion combined with the quality of expert refactoring.
Our team of seasoned developers and architects has extensive experience in migrating VB applications to modern platforms, including .NET, Azure, and cloud-native environments. We've developed a proven methodology that ensures a smooth transition, minimizing disruption to your business operations.
Manual migration is labor-intensive and error-prone. VB Migration Partner automates 80-90% of the heavy lifting, drastically reducing the man-hours required for the project.
The tool allows developers to inject "migration pragmas"—special comments that instruct the engine on how to handle specific code blocks. This enables teams to:
is not just a converter; it is an enterprise-grade migration engine developed by a team of recognized .NET experts, including former Microsoft MVPs. It bridges the gap between the rigid structure of legacy VB and the object-oriented power of C# and .NET Core.
The standard .NET Anchor property behaves differently. Instead, use the Migration Partner’s interceptor:
Migrating to C# opens the door to: